Claim. There is an explicit structural certificate whose fields assert: (i) the channel-side response $R_C$ of the canonical recognition-coupled factorization is amplitude-linear; (ii) if that response is density-only then $R_C\varphi=0$ for every eight-tick signal $\varphi$; (iii) the master-theorem hypothesis that amplitude-linearity is forced unconditionally (via the canonical structural Prop) is inhabited.
background
Track 2.C/2.D studies channel-side response maps on eight-tick signals under a recognition-coupled factorizable joint substrate: a named factor-product hypothesis with the recognition update on the matter side. The canonical witness canonicalRecognitionCoupled equips both factors with cyclic shift and sets the matter factor equal to the recognition update by reflexivity.
The upstream headline track2C_headline states that under any such recognition-coupled factorization the channel response is forced amplitude-linear, and any density-only (CPTP-classical) candidate collapses to the zero response. That is paper IV's T2 forced from substrate under the binary-tensor factor-product axiom: a structural theorem, not yet an unconditional lift to arbitrary joint operators.
This module's structure AmplitudeLinearForcedStructuralCert packages those two conclusions on the canonical coupling together with an inhabitant of Gravity.MasterTheorem.AmplitudeLinearForcedUnconditional, so the master theorem can consume a single cert object.
proof idea
One-line record construction. The first field is the left projection of track2C_headline applied to canonicalRecognitionCoupled (amplitude-linearity of $R_C$). The second field is the right projection of the same headline (density-only implies identically zero). The third field is the already-built amplitudeLinearForcedUnconditionalWitness, which wraps the canonical structural Prop as the master-theorem hypothesis input. No additional tactics or lemmas beyond those two projections and the witness def.
